Download Torrent Using Linux Terminal
In this post we are going to you show you how to download torrent in Linux using terminal. This method is useful when your PC has limited amount of memory (RAM), also if you have a VPS it would be really helpful to download. Here we are going to use a application called rTorrent to download torrent via terminal and I am using Ubuntu Linux 13.04 distribution. Just follow the instructions step by step to download torrent via terminal.
Instructions:
1. Open the Terminal.
2. Download rTorrent using the command in terminal in debian based systems.
2. Download rTorrent using the command in terminal in debian based systems.
sudo apt-get install rtorrent
To download rTorrent in fedora based systems use this command.
yum install rtorrent
3. After installing rTorrent open it using the command rtorrent in terminal. It opens rTorrent UI.
4. Press “Enter” it will show “load.normal>” at the bottom of the window.
5. Now copy the URL of torrent file and paste it. For example “http://torcache.net/torrent/4134288834E6B8C768760EA0A4C308444DD421FD.torrent”. Then press enter.
6. It loads the torrent and it will not download.
5. Now copy the URL of torrent file and paste it. For example “http://torcache.net/torrent/4134288834E6B8C768760EA0A4C308444DD421FD.torrent”. Then press enter.
6. It loads the torrent and it will not download.
7. Press Down or Up arrow key to select the loaded torrent and then Press “Ctrl+S”. The selected torrent will be denoted by “*” symbol.
8. Now your torrent starts downloading.
8. Now your torrent starts downloading.
That would be enough to get you downloading torrent files via the Linux terminal in no time. But if you want to learn some of the more advanced features of rTorrent, don't rely on its man page because you will be disappointed. Instead, use this cheat sheet:
Adding and removing torrents
Backspace -- Add torrent using an URL or file path. Use tab to view directory content and do auto-complete. Also, wildcards can be used. For example: ~/torrent/*
Return/Enter -- Same as backspace, except the torrent remains inactive. (Use ^s to activate)
CTRL-O -- Set new download directory for selected torrent. Only works if torrent has not yet been activated.
CTRL-S -- Start download. Runs hash first unless already done.
CTRL-D -- Stop an active download, or remove a stopped download.
CTRL-R -- Initiate hash check of torrent. Without starting to download/upload.

Send Self-Destructing Emails & SMS To Anyone
Emails and SMS both are very fast services to send information easily and fast in written format. We not only use these services for chit-chat but many times we use emails or SMS to send very confidential information such as any account’s password, credit card number, ATM PIN, etc.
After sending emails/SMS if you don’t want anyone else to read your message, it is recommended to use self-destructing messages. These messages when read once, will automatically gets deleted. So, the recipient will get the needed information and no one would able to know confidential message that you sent using self-destructing message service.
Self Destruction Warning Message ;)
Today, I am going to talk about some FREE services and tools that will let you send self-destructing emails as well as SMS which will automatically destruct when they read once.
1. SECRETINK
SecretInk is a powerful startup that lets you send both self-destructing emails and SMS for free. SecretInk send private link through email/SMS to receiver from where they will read your secret message. After reading the link and its message both will get destroyed.
All you need to do is just go and login SecretInk with your Google/Gmail account and you’re good to go. Now you can send unlimited self-destructing emails. Your message will be fully anonymous. That means, you can add different Reply-To email/SMS address and receiver will have no trace about who send the message.
2. DESTRUCTINGMESSAGE.COM
It is another great website to send self-destructing emails. Unlike SecretInk, you can send time for self-destruct from 15 seconds to 5 minutes. Similar to SecretInk, your email will be anonymous unless you add personal identifiable information inside email.
You can type your secret self-destructing message and generate link that you can send your friend through SMS, facebook message etc. Generated link will be active for 90 days before opening it and read secret message.
3. GHOSTMAIL
If you didn’t find the self-destructing service that can fulfil your need then here is GhostMail for that. Rather than sending a link through email, GhostMail send direct self-destructing email to the receiver. The receiver is not required to visit any link to read your email.
Once receiver reads your email, you’ll get notified at GhostMail account and the email will be vanished from receiver’s webmail. Creating GhostMail account is free and you’re required to sign in your Gmail/Google account to create your account here.
4. MOBILE APPS TO SEND SELF-DESTRUCTING SMS
Unfortunately, not a single web service is available that let you send direct self-destructing SMS without making receiver navigate to a link but Wickr App available for both Android and iOS device will let you do this. Wickr is available for free to use at both the platforms. It lets you send self-destructing, secure, private, anonymous messages & media easily.
5. BROWSER EXTENSIONS
Two chrome browser extensions, Boomerang Gmail and mxHero Toolbar are available to supercharge your Gmail experience. Boomerang Gmail is paid while mxHero Toolbar is a free extensions. Both of these extensions adds features like email tracking, scheduled emails, private delivery features to Chrome with Self-destructing email feature too.
The self-destructing email sent via any of these extensions will not be direct, no link would be sent to receiver to visit and read out your secret message

Create An Android App Without Any Coding
Android users generally prefer to use an app when searching for information online because of the mobile friendly interface. Previously, it was quite difficult to create an Android app from scratch, since it required coding and app development knowledge. AppsGeyser has removed the barrier to entry for small business owners who want to create their own apps and reach customers who are on the go.
First, you’ll most likely want to submit it to the Android Market. Keep in mind that Google charges a $25 publisher’s fee. However, your app will reach millions of users with Android phones.
How Does AppsGeyser Work?
AppsGeyser is touted as being super simple to use – and it is.
You start by going to the AppsGeyser. Once you’re there, you can click one of the three “Create App” buttons. This takes you to step one in the process.
There are actually several options to choose from. You can enter a URL, create a shortcuts list, create a specialty app, and there are several other options. For example, you can insert HTML code or create an app from a Youtube channel. For the sake of this demo, we’ll choose to enter a URL.
Say we want to create an app for the Bluecloud Solutions blog. All you have to do is paste the URL into the field and give your app a name and description. You can also create a custom icon if you’d like.
Once you input the information, you can see a nice little preview on the right hand side of the screen. When you have everything filled in and looking the way you want, you hit the “Create App” button.
Next, you’ll land on a page where you’ll need to fill out your name, email address, and password to create an account. Once you fill in all your information, you can hit the “Sign-Up” button.
The last thing you’ll need to do is download the .apk file from the AppsGeyser website. Test out your app and make changes, if required. You can edit your app by logging in to your AppsGeyser Dashboard. Once you’re happy with the app, you can publish it, or just keep it for personal use.

Remove Attribution Widget From Blogger
- Open the blogger dashboard and open the layout tab.
- Click on the small “Edit” button next to the widget you want to unlock.
- If the widget doesn’t have any remove option then it is locked. Copy the widget’s ID from the top URL of the widget that is it looks something similar as "WidgetID='something’".
- Navigate to the “Template” tab and click on the “Edit HTML” button.
- Press “Ctrl + F” and search for the widget ID.
- Now this is where you need to do a small editing to the widget. There are two ways to do that.
- When you search for the widget ID you will see its attribute locked = “True”.
- Replace the word Ture as False and save the template. Now your widget is unlocked.
- Again open the layout => edit widget. You will find the option “Remove” and click on it to delete the widget.

Setup Custom Domain In Blogger Using Freenom
- Go to Freenom
- Enter your desire domain and select .tk from the option, click on “Search” button, same below screenshot.
- If your desired domain is available then you redirect on Domain Registration page set registration length as 12 months and like this screenshot below. If not, then try any other domain name.
- Click Order Now button. Here you have to verify your account by email, Verification link Sent to Your Email The Link, go to your Email Index and Click On The Link it redirect to checkout Page.
- Don't worry about it Fill the form give Email ID and Password Login further to Setup Domain in Blogger. Congratulation you have get your Domain, get ready for Setup custom domain in Blogger.
SETUP CUSTOM FREE DOMAIN IN BLOGGER
- Go to Blogger Settings and find Publishing option in your dashboard. Now click on Set up a third-party URL for your blog.
- Then enter your Dot Tk domain with www in the like www.technohalf-demo.tk (as shown in the picture).
- Hit Save button, you get a Error i.e. We have not been able to verify your authority to this domain. Error 12. Now That's what we require, two CNAME like below picture. Don't close this Page.
- Open a New Tab in Browser and Go to Your Freenom ClientArea Link and click on Domain Panel and then click on “My Domain” same below screenshot.
- It will take to your Domain Page and click on “Manage Domain”. Like this-
- Now clicked on Manage Freenom DNS and it will take to DNS MANAGEMENT for yourdoamin.tk
- First of all Select “CNAME Record” from type option then write “www” in Name and “ghs.google.com” in Target and Leave TTL to 14440 .
- Again to add another CNAME click on “More Records” and then write Host Name and Target that you got in error . You can do it same below image.
- OK you have added your CNAME records successfully Let's add "A Record". Clicked on More Records, select “A Record” from type and Leave Name to Blank and set TTL to 300. Set First "Target" to 216.239.32.21. Again repeat this process and Add Second "Target" to 216.239.34.21, Third "Target" to 216.239.36.21, Fourth "Target" to 216.239.38.21 like this Screenshot Below.
- You have done your job well click Save Change to get effect. Now! Just Wait around 5 to 10 minutes and then go to your Blogger account and got to Setting>>Basic>> Add a Custom Domain and enter your www.yourdomain.tk (Don't Forget to add www before domain name) domain.
- Before saving check the Redirect Option otherwise no one can visit your domain unless and until 'www' is put before your domain. ('yourdomain.tk' can not be redirected to 'www.yourdomain.com').
